The public Polish television Telewizja Polska SA (TVP) launched a free-to-air platform on ASTRA on 15th September 2009. TVP has therefore extended its satellite capacity contracts for the use of two transponders at ASTRA’s main orbital position 19.2 degrees East. TVP has been using this capacity since 2005. On 16th of September 2009, subscribers of the satellite platform CYFRA+ have gained an access to Animal Planet HD. Until 11th of November channel can be viewed by all subscribers of the platform with has at least one HD option activated. This is the ninth high-definition channel available in CYFRA+, other ones include: CANAL+ Film HD, CANAL+ Sport HD, National Geographic Channel HD, HBO HD, Filmbox HD, MTVNHD, Eurosport HD and Eurosport 2 HD. ››

The BBC and Arqiva have announced that the agreement to upgrade the relevant parts of the UK digital terrestrial television (DTT) transmission network to DVB-T2 has been confirmed. The new DVB-T2 technology will deliver an increase in capacity of 67% to the BBC’s Multiplex B, efficiently creating the space needed for UK public service broadcasters' HD transmissions. more ››
Multilingual news channel euronews is the only international news channel available on the first DTT platform in Latvia - Lattelecom, launched in August 2009. euronews is offered in the economic and basic packages and is available in four languages: English, French, German and Russian on channel 11. Lattelecom also distributes this channel on its IPTV platform. more ››
On 28 August 2009, Antenna Hungária started the free-to-air test of euronews on the MinDig TV digital terrestrial television service available in SD format. It is broadcast in the Budapest region on channel 62, in the Kabhegy region on channel 61, and in the Szentes region on channel 65. With the addition of the new programme, the free-to-air offer of the MinDig TV service comprises seven TV programmes and three radio programmes. more ››

National Broadcasting Council has expanded concessions of nationwide broadcasters to the possibility of a digital terrestrial broadcasting in the first multiplex. This means that the first multiplex will include Polsat, TVN, TV4 and TV Puls and three TVP channels. more ››
TV Puls plans to immediately apply for a reservation of the frequency in first DVB-T multiplex. Presence of TV Puls in DVB-T will increase channel's availability to 100% of the country. Station wants to launch two thematical channels in the second multiplex. more ››
People who live in Warsaw and the surrounding area have now DVB-T access to the first local ITI Group channel - TVN Warszawa. Transmission is a part of experimental POT (Polish Television Operator) DVB-T signal in MPEG-2 on channel 55 (746 MHz), 1.3 kW of power from the Palace of Culture and Science in Warsaw.
